Good practice course
Great little 9 hole course , maintained to a decent standard throughout . Good mixture of mid length holes and greens are very well looked after. As a high handicap golfer it's an ideal course to practice on , quite forgiving fairways but also a few snags and water holes that can catch you out . 9 holes can easily be done in an hour and a half so ideal to drop in after work and play a quick 9 or have the option to go round twice for the full 18. Also has a driving range that is reasonably priced and the mats are to a good standard . Selection of cold drinks and snacks available at payment point and various golf items for sale if you forget something . Staff are friendly and helpful.All in all as a short course it offers someone of my level an opportunity to sharpen my game prior to taking on bigger courses in the area. Would recommend if you have a spare couple of hours and want to hit some greens
